#797385 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#797385 is composed of 47.5% red, 45.1% green and 52.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 9% cyan, 13.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 47.8% black. It has a hue angle of 260 degrees, a saturation of 7.3% and a lightness of 48.6%. #797385 color hex could be obtained by blending #f2e6ff with #00000b. Closest websafe color is: #666699.

● #797385 color description : Dark grayish violet.
#797385 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#797385 has RGB values of R:121, G:115, B:133 and CMYK values of C:0.09, M:0.14, Y:0, K:0.48. Its decimal value is 7959429.
